Extended Business Description
Stoneridge, Inc. designs and manufactures engineered electrical and electronic components, modules and systems for the commercial vehicle, automotive, agricultural and off-highway vehicle markets. The company operates through four segments: Electronics, Wiring, Control Devices and PST. The Electronic segment designs and manufactures electronic instrument clusters, electronic control units, driver information systems and electrical distribution systems. This segment also assembles entire instrument panels for the medium-and heavy-duty truck markets that are configured specifically to the OEM customer's specifications. The Wiring segment produces electrical power and signal distribution systems, primarily wiring harnesses and connectors and instrument panel assemblies. The Control Devices segment designs and manufactures products that monitor measure or activate specific functions within a vehicle. It also designs and manufactures electromechanical actuator products that enable OEMs to deploy power functions in a vehicle and can be designed to integrate switching and control functions. The PST segment specializes in the design, manufacture and sale of electronic vehicle security alarms, convenience accessories, vehicle tracking devices and monitoring services and in-vehicle audio and video devices primarily for the automotive and motorcycle industry. Stoneridge was founded by D.M. Draime in 1965 and is headquartered in Warren, OH.

Covered Call Strategy Risks: While covered call writing is often considered a conservative options strategy, it is not without risk. By selling a covered call, you are limiting your potential upside profit from the underlying stock. You remain exposed to the full downside risk of owning the underlying stock. In the event of a significant decline in the stock price, the premium received may not be sufficient to offset your losses.
